Arrival by bus

Lüneburg is located on the train line between Hannover and Hamburg. You can travel to Lüneburg from Hamburg every half hour and from Hannover once an hour. Lüneburg is within the commuter zone for the Hamburg rapid transit system (HVV).

  • Departing from the Lüneburg train station, two different buses travel to the Scharnhorststraße campus.  They each leave every fifteen minutes. You can take either bus 5011 (towards Rettmer/Häcklingen) or bus 5012 (towards Bockelsberg). You need to get off the bus at the Blücherstraße stop.
  • A university shuttle bus, number 5001, runs during the semester from the train station to the Universitätsallee Campus and the Rotes Feld Campus.
  • For lectures at Volgershall you can take bus number 5013 towards Reppenstedt.

Ride-Share Service

In the evening when buses are no longer running (after 9:00pm), the ASM ride-share service is available, which brings Leuphana students to their destination until 1:00 AM on workdays and Saturday nights/Sunday mornings until 3:00 AM for a reduced fare. You need to call in your desired destination to the ASM-dispatcher at least 30 minutes before the planned departure time. The phone number is +49.4131.533.44. The rates, schedules and drop-off locations are listed on the ASM-website.

Arrival by car

While on-campus parking is limited, public transportation in Lüneburg is excellent. Our three Leuphana campuses are very well connected to Lüneburg’s bus and railway network. Join in the Leuphana spirit of a sustainable campus and contribute to environmental protection by using the local transportation network or a bicycle.  
A bicycle is the most popular means of transport on and to the campus. In front of each building and lecture hall are bicycle stands, and there is Kon-RAD, a student-run repair shop. On-campus, at the railway station and in the city you will find Stadt-RAD (Sharing Concept) bikes.

University Campus

  • From the South: Take the federal highway A7 Hannover-Hamburg until you reach the Soltau-Ost exit, from there take state highway 209 to Lüneburg.   From there, follow the road signs to the university campus.
  • From the North: Take the A39 Hamburg-Lüneburg highway and then go onto the eastern by-pass until the Lüneburg-Häcklingen exit. Then follow the road signs to the university campus. 
  • Parking: Please obey the parking regulations on campus. Please park only in official designated parking locations. Illegally parked cars will be towed.  View campus map.
